Game Drives: Prime Wildlife Viewing Across East Africa
Savannahs, Plains, and National Parks
Game drives are the cornerstone of East African safaris. In Uganda, the Kasenyi Plains in Queen Elizabeth National Park provide excellent visibility of lions hunting Uganda kob herds, elephants, buffaloes, warthogs, and bushbucks.
In Kenya, the Maasai Mara National Reserve offers dramatic predator-prey action during the Great Migration, where lions, cheetahs, and hyenas pursue wildebeest and zebras. Tanzania’s Serengeti National Park features vast plains and rolling hills, perfect for spotting migrating herds and resident wildlife, while Rwanda’s Akagera National Park provides a mix of savannah and wetlands, home to elephants, giraffes, hippos, and tree-climbing lions.

Boat Safaris: Wetlands and Waterway Wildlife
Observing Hippos, Crocodiles, and Birdlife
East Africa’s waterways offer unparalleled wildlife encounters. In Uganda, a boat safari on the Kazinga Channel connects Lake Edward and Lake George, revealing hippos, crocodiles, elephants, buffaloes, and abundant waterbirds.
Kenya’s Lake Naivasha and Lamu wetlands host hippos, herons, kingfishers, and other aquatic wildlife. Tanzania’s Selous Game Reserve and Lake Manyara offer boat trips to observe hippos, elephants, and rare bird species. Rwanda’s Lake Ihema in Akagera National Park provides scenic boat cruises amidst hippos and birdlife.

Primate Tracking: Chimpanzees and Gorillas
Forest Treks and Mountain Gorilla Encounters
East Africa is a global hotspot for primate experiences. Uganda’s Kyambura Gorge and Kalinzu Forest offer guided chimpanzee trekking, while Bwindi Impenetrable Forest and Rwanda’s Volcanoes National Park host habituated mountain gorillas.
Trekkers hike dense forests with expert guides, observing primates in their natural habitats and learning about their behaviors, conservation, and ecological roles. Unique Wildlife Highlights Across Countries
- Tree-Climbing Lions (Ishasha, Uganda & Akagera, Rwanda): Rare behavior where lions rest in fig trees.
- The Great Migration (Maasai Mara & Serengeti): Millions of wildebeest and zebras cross rivers in a dramatic spectacle.
- Ngorongoro Crater (Tanzania): Dense wildlife populations including black rhinos in a volcanic caldera.
- Akagera Savanna (Rwanda): Home to Big Five species and abundant birdlife.
